Present: regional leads and branch management reps.

Main item was the proposed sale of the Fennick Logistics unit. Leadership confirmed due diligence is underway with a shortlisted buyer; staff consultations begin next month. Branch managers were asked to keep day-to-day operations steady and route all questions to the transition office rather than speculating locally. Timelines remain fluid until contracts are exchanged. The board's reasoning, shared in confidence, appears directly below these minutes.

confidential, kagap-kajeg: Istethax Holdings is in early talks to buy Ulaielix Works for about $23.7 million. The Lamys launch date is July 6, and nothing goes to the press before then.

- [ ] **Step 7: Breaker override escrow.** After sealing the signing keys for the Tallgrove upstream API circuit breaker, confirm the support team can force the breaker open during a full outage. The override bundle lives in the sealed escrow drawer and is useless without its unlock phrase. Two ceremony witnesses must initial this step before proceeding. The escrow bundle is decrypted with the recovery passphrase that follows.

vault phrase of kahip-kahop = holath-quenmir

Title: Scheduler double-waters bed 3 after DST shift

New folks: the Verdella scheduler stores watering slots in local time. After the clock change, slot 06:00 fires twice, soaking the herb bed. Fix: store UTC, convert at display. Repro on the Oakhollow test rig only. To reproduce, install the firmware identified by the token below.

build token for hafop-kahog: htk31_a432ac515d5bb1362002c1e1a7e80ef

- [ ] Verify waveform preview renders correctly in Soundline's clip editor after the canvas refactor. Check peak downsampling at zoom levels 1x–32x, confirm no off-by-one at clip boundaries, and validate mono/stereo merge behavior. Render time must stay under 40ms for a 10-minute file on the reference laptop. Flag any antialiasing regression against the golden screenshots in the review bundle. Confirm the fix landed in the build identified by the token below.

pipeline stamp: htk21_86b657ac0aa916a9af17f